Matthew 8:14 - Exposition

And when Jesus was come into Peter's house. Straight from the synagogue (parallel passages), for food, Matthew 8:15 (Chrysostom). It seems clear, from the parallel passages, that St. Peter had not previously told our Lord about his mother-in-law's illness, but that he, with others, now asked ( ἠρώτησαν , Luke) him to heal her. Among these others were probably Andrew, who also lived in the house, and James and John, who accompanied our Lord (Mark). Whether or not it was Peter's own house, we have no means of telling (but see next verse). He saw . Presumably on entering, before they asked him about her. His wife's mother ( 1 Corinthians 9:5 ). As St. Peter lived for some forty years more, he can hardly have been now very long married (cf. Bengel). Laid ( βεβλημένην ); verse 6. And sick of a fever .
